Mega Gardevoir (Pseudo)

[OVERVIEW]

There is absolutely no reason to use Mega Gardevoir in OU. Aside from a stronger Fairy-type STAB move, a slightly better Speed tier, and access to some nifty utility moves like Will-O-Wisp and Healing Wish, Gardevoir is entirely outclassed by Tapu Lele, which can run an item, doesn't take up your Mega slot, and has stronger Psychic-type moves thanks to Psychic Terrain. It is also outclassed by Mega Alakazam, which is much faster and stronger and has access to recovery.

[SET COMMENTS]

The set aims to distinguish itself from the other, frankly better Psychic-types in the tier by virtue of some of the cool utility moves Mega Gardevoir has access to; for example, it can cripple some switch-ins like Celesteela and Magearna with Will-O-Wisp or fully heal a useful teammate with Healing Wish and let it switch in freely. However, there is still little to no reason to use it over Tapu Lele and Mega Alakazam.
